Leadership Austin

File

Leadership Austin ignites passion for civic engagement and community leadership.

Leadership Austin offers established and emerging business and community leaders a unique opportunity to be part of a group that has come together to:

Develop their personal and professional leadership skills;
Learn about the issues affecting Greater Austin through open and balanced civic discussion; and,
Build relationships with others who seek to find solutions to the issues facing our region.

Membership Details

A diverse range of leaders and influencers from across the Greater Austin region.

Our flagship program, Essential, and our program for rising leaders, Emerge, are application-based. Each year, we build cohorts (50-60 people each) for a 8-9 month experience. Tuition fees do apply, but there is no ongoing fees for alumni. Typically, organizations pay the cost of professional development training. Scholarships are also available.

Additional Engage events and training opportunities are open to the public and companies throughout the year.

Events, Programs, and Meetings

Essential: Expand your impact, reimagine systems, and develop meaningful relationships with other civic leaders.
Emerge: Ignite your passion while developing new leadership skills, and learn to make a lasting impact in our region.
Engage: Thought-provoking conversations about complex issues impacting the health of our community.

Leadership Opportunities

Alumni are eligible to serve as Board members, Committee Chairs & members
